1. Concrete Slab Foundation
A concrete slab foundation is exactly what it sounds like: a solid slab of concrete poured directly onto the ground. This type of foundation is a popular choice for modular homes because it's relatively simple and cost-effective to build. The slab is usually poured over a bed of gravel and includes steel reinforcement to provide strength and prevent cracking. Slabs are great for areas with stable soil conditions and are often used in warmer climates. They provide a flat, level surface that's perfect for modular home modules to be placed upon. This foundation type is known for its durability and resistance to pests and moisture. It also provides excellent support and stability for the modular home, ensuring it remains level over time. There are a few different types of slab foundations. A monolithic slab has the footings and the slab poured all at once, creating a single, continuous structure. This design is simple and cost-effective. A slab-on-grade is poured at or slightly above ground level. This option is common in areas where the ground is relatively stable and there's no need for a crawl space or basement. With a slab foundation, the modular home is placed directly on top of the concrete. This provides a solid and level base for the modules. The modules are then secured to the slab using anchors and other fasteners, ensuring that the home is securely attached to the foundation. This method of construction also reduces the risk of water damage and pests, as there are no gaps or spaces between the foundation and the home. One thing to consider is insulation. To improve energy efficiency, the slab should be properly insulated, either with insulation boards under the slab or around the edges. This helps prevent heat loss in the winter and heat gain in the summer. Slabs can also be designed with radiant floor heating, providing an efficient and comfortable heating system. Overall, concrete slab foundations are a reliable and cost-effective choice for modular home foundations, especially in areas with favorable soil conditions. They provide a stable and level base, making them an excellent choice for modular home construction.
2. Crawl Space Foundation
A crawl space foundation is a raised foundation that creates a small, unfinished space between the ground and the floor of your home. This space is typically a few feet high, allowing for access to plumbing, electrical wiring, and HVAC systems. Crawl spaces offer some advantages over slab foundations, especially in areas with uneven terrain or poor soil conditions. They can also provide a buffer against moisture and pests. Crawl spaces are built by constructing concrete or cinder block walls that sit on a footing. These walls create an enclosed space that supports the home above. The height of the crawl space can vary, but it's typically high enough to allow for easy access to utilities. Crawl spaces are generally more expensive to build than slab foundations. They also require more maintenance to ensure they remain dry and pest-free. However, they can be a good option if you need space for utilities or if you want to avoid having your home directly on the ground. A crawl space foundation is constructed by building concrete or cinder block walls that sit on a footing. These walls form the perimeter of the foundation and support the structure above. The crawl space allows for easy access to utilities, such as plumbing and electrical wiring. This makes it easier to install, maintain, and repair these systems. A well-designed and properly ventilated crawl space can help prevent moisture buildup, which can lead to mold and mildew. This is particularly important in areas with high humidity. Proper ventilation and insulation are essential to ensure that the crawl space remains dry and energy-efficient. Crawl spaces also provide flexibility in terms of home design. The crawl space can accommodate uneven terrain and allow for changes in elevation. This can be beneficial in areas where the ground slopes or is not perfectly level. The downside is that they can be more susceptible to pests and require more maintenance than other foundation types. You'll need to make sure the crawl space is properly sealed, ventilated, and insulated to prevent moisture buildup and pest infestations. Overall, crawl space foundations offer a good balance of cost, functionality, and flexibility for modular homes.
3. Basement Foundation
A basement foundation provides a fully finished or unfinished living space below your home. This can be a great way to add extra living area, storage space, or even a workshop. Basement foundations are the most expensive type of foundation, but they can significantly increase the value of your home. They are built by excavating the area under your home and pouring concrete walls and a floor. Basement foundations are constructed by excavating the area under your home to the desired depth. Concrete walls are then poured, and a concrete floor is laid. The basement walls are designed to withstand the pressure of the surrounding soil and to prevent water from entering the space. Basements offer a wealth of potential living space. They can be finished to create additional bedrooms, living areas, or even home theaters. They can also be used for storage, utility rooms, and other purposes. The key to a successful basement is proper waterproofing and drainage. This prevents water from seeping into the basement and causing damage to the structure or belongings. The basement walls and floor should be properly sealed, and a drainage system should be installed to direct water away from the foundation. The benefits of a basement foundation for a modular home are numerous. They provide additional living space, increase the value of the home, and offer protection from the elements. Basements also offer flexibility in terms of design and can accommodate a variety of needs. Basements are a premium option and offer the most flexibility in terms of useable space. However, they are also the most expensive to construct. A basement adds significant value to your home and provides a versatile space that can be customized to your needs.

1. Soil Conditions
One of the most important things to consider is the soil conditions at your building site. Different types of soil have different load-bearing capacities. This means some soils are better at supporting the weight of a house than others. Your local building department will likely require a soil test to determine the soil's composition and its ability to support your home. Based on the soil test results, you can determine which foundation type is most suitable. For example, if you have unstable soil, you may need a deeper foundation or a foundation with extra reinforcement. In some cases, the soil may need to be compacted or treated before construction can begin. The soil's ability to support the weight of the home is critical, and a soil test will provide valuable information. It's also important to consider the soil's drainage characteristics. Poor drainage can lead to water problems, which can damage your foundation and home. The soil's composition can vary significantly from one area to another. Knowing the soil composition will help determine the appropriate type of foundation. Consulting with a geotechnical engineer is often recommended to assess soil conditions and make recommendations. They can analyze the soil and recommend the best foundation type. It’s also crucial that a soil test is performed to understand the characteristics and stability of the soil. This will give you the information needed to create a sturdy and long-lasting foundation.

3. Budget
Of course, your budget is a major factor. The cost of a foundation can vary significantly depending on the type you choose, the size of your home, and the soil conditions. Get quotes from several contractors to get a realistic idea of the cost. Slab foundations are generally the most affordable, followed by crawl space foundations, and then basement foundations. Keep in mind that the initial cost isn't the only thing to consider. You should also factor in the long-term costs of maintenance and repairs. For example, a basement foundation may be more expensive upfront, but it can also increase the value of your home. It's important to weigh the pros and cons of each foundation type to determine which option offers the best value for your money. Think about what you can afford and what you're willing to invest in the long term. Costs may vary based on materials, labor, and site preparation. Getting multiple quotes from different contractors is always a good idea. Make sure the quotes are detailed and include all the costs associated with the foundation. Consider the ongoing expenses such as maintenance and repairs. Basements, for example, may require waterproofing and drainage systems. Planning for potential future renovations is also a good idea. If you think you might want to add additional living space in the future, a basement foundation might be a good investment. Ultimately, the budget is an important factor when deciding on modular home foundations. Take the time to plan your budget and make sure that you can afford the foundation you choose. Choose a foundation that balances your needs and budget.
4. Climate and Weather
Also, consider the climate and weather in your area. If you live in a region with heavy rainfall or snowfall, you'll need a foundation that can handle those conditions. A foundation in a high-wind area should be built to withstand those forces. Areas prone to flooding may require a foundation that is elevated above the flood level. For example, in areas with harsh winters, a basement foundation may be a good choice because it provides additional insulation and protection from the cold. In areas with high humidity, a crawl space foundation might be preferred to allow for better ventilation and moisture control. The foundation should be designed to handle the specific conditions of your area. Ensure your foundation is designed to handle the expected weather conditions, as this ensures your home's longevity. This means considering factors like the amount of rainfall, snowfall, and the potential for flooding. In areas prone to earthquakes, you will need a foundation designed to withstand those forces. Your local building codes will provide guidance on the necessary requirements. A professional engineer can help design a foundation that meets the requirements. Your location’s climate and weather conditions can heavily influence your foundation choice, such as frost lines, wind, and seismic activity.
